Towing Fundamentals

Many new truck owners jump straight into towing without grasping core concepts like payload, gross trailer weight, or tongue weight. These measurements determine safe towing capacity; for example, a 2023 Ford F-150 has a maximum towing capacity from 8,000 to 14,000 pounds depending on the engine and configuration. Misjudging these numbers risks damage to your truck and trailer. Actual towing feels different on road — braking distance increases, and acceleration slows noticeably.

A practical example: towing a 5,000-pound camper requires confirming your truck’s hitch rating meets or exceeds that weight along with the trailer’s tongue load, typically 10-15% of trailer weight. Knowing these values upfront saves headaches on highways or steep grades.

Aligning hitch height is critical. Trailering mismatches cause sway, which starts subtle but can escalate to dangerous oscillations. Sway control mechanisms, like built-in friction devices or electronic systems, mitigate this.

Practical Towing Tips

Match truck and trailer ratings

Start by checking your truck’s maximum towing capacity in the owner’s manual or manufacturer website. Cross-check it with the trailer’s gross weight and tongue weight. This practice prevents chassis overload and mechanical failure. A Dodge Ram 2500, for instance, safely hauls up to 19,680 lbs with proper setup.

Choose the right hitch

Hitches come in classes 1 to 5; for heavy-duty towing, a Class 4 hitch suits most full-size pickups best. It holds between 10,000 and 14,000 lbs and resists twisting forces better than Class 3. You’ll see brands like Reese or CURT dominate this market—CURT’s 4-point Hitch locks, a newer iteration, resist unplanned detachment better, something that matters on bumpy roads.

Use electronic brake controllers

Installing a brake controller is non-negotiable for trailers above 3,000 pounds. These devices modulate trailer brakes in sync with the truck’s brake pedal. Tekonsha Prodigy P3 is popular for its customizable gain and rugged build. Proper setup with manual gain adjustment reduces trailer fishtailing by up to 30% based on user reviews over five years.

Balance the load carefully

Load placement affects stability. Keep 60% of the trailer weight over the front axle, 40% on the rear. Avoid excessive rear loading because it induces trailer sway. I regularly advise clients to pack heavier gear towards the front for better control. Even a change of 100 pounds shifted can alter the feel drastically on curvy roads.

Regular maintenance checks

Trailer wiring harnesses often corrode or fray, especially in hauling salt-damaged vehicles or boats stored outdoors during winter. Inspect connections monthly if towing frequently; replace worn sockets immediately. Trailer tires also need their own upkeep: check tread depth not below 4/32 inches before long trips and rotate tires every 5,000 miles.

Safety gear and lights

Confirm all brake lights, marker lights, and turn signals work before every trip. An inline tester or trailer wiring tester—most cost under $20—can diagnose faulty wiring quickly. It's a critical last step, though often skipped during quick loading.

Practice towing before real trips

Drive in low-traffic areas to gauge your truck’s reactions while towing. Accelerating and braking feel different. Try tight turns and backing maneuvers repeatedly. Handy tip: attach a backpack or heavy object inside the cab during practice to mimic extra weight, it changes handling slightly.

Understand braking differences

Your truck’s ABS system doesn’t control trailer brakes; the controller independently modulates them. The trailer can slide unexpectedly on slick roads if braking isn’t balanced. Slowing down early helps — braking distances can increase by over 50% towing heavy trailers.

Invest in sway control devices

Even with perfect loading, gusty winds or sudden maneuvers trigger sway. Weight-distributing hitch bars combined with friction sway control devices reduce lateral movements drastically. Look for brands like Blue Ox, rated highly by towing communities as of 2023. Their products often add 15–20 pounds of hitch weight but improve control visibly.

Frequent Towing Errors

Ignoring tongue weight is common. People often overload the rear, thinking the trailer tongue doesn't matter, but tongue weight should be 10-15% of total trailer weight to maintain control. Exceeding that leads to fishtailing and instability.

Skipping brake controller calibration — some truck owners set it once, then forget. This causes jerky stops or underperforming brakes. Recalibrate for changes in load or trailer condition annually.

Failing to inspect wiring and lights before trips plagues many drivers. A broken taillight invites tickets or accidents. If wiring feels brittle or you notice flickering lights on the trailer, replace wiring connectors immediately.

Overheating trailer brakes without noticing. Brake fade happens on steep declines if you rely on the truck’s brakes only and ignore the trailer’s. Use lower gears and trailer brake app to avoid overheating.
